Khan Resources Inc. (CNSX:KRI) ("Khan" or the "Company") is pleased to announce
that the Tribunal hearing the Company's $200 million international arbitration
action against the Government of Mongolia has ruled entirely in Khan's favour on
matters of jurisdiction and has dismissed all of Mongolia's objections to the
continuance of the suit. The action will now progress to the phase in which the
panel will rule as to the merits of the arbitral claims and the amount of
damages suffered by Khan arising from the Mongolian Government's expropriatory
and unlawful treatment of Khan in relation to the Dornod uranium deposit located
in northeastern Mongolia. Khan initiated the international arbitration suit in
January, 2011.
